public IQuery<IInstallableUnit> createQuery() {
List<IQuery<IInstallableUnit>> queries = new ArrayList<>();
if (id != null) {
if (version == null || version.length() == 0) {
// Get the latest version of the iu
queries.add(QueryUtil.createLatestQuery(QueryUtil.createIUQuery(id)));
} else {
Version iuVersion = Version.parseVersion(version);
queries.add(QueryUtil.createIUQuery(id, iuVersion));
}
}
IQuery<IInstallableUnit> iuQuery = processQueryString();
if (iuQuery != null)
queries.add(iuQuery);
if (queries.size() == 1)
return queries.get(0);
IQuery<IInstallableUnit> query = QueryUtil.createPipeQuery(queries);
return query;
}
private IQuery<IInstallableUnit> processQueryString() {
if (queryString == null)
return null;
int startIdx = queryString.indexOf('[');
int endIdx = queryString.lastIndexOf(']');
if (startIdx == -1 || endIdx == -1 || endIdx < startIdx)
return null;
String element = queryString.substring(0, startIdx);
Map<String, String> attributes = processQueryAttributes(queryString.substring(startIdx + 1, endIdx));
if (element.equals(QUERY_PROPERTY)) {
String name = attributes.get(QUERY_NAME);
String value = attributes.get(QUERY_VALUE);
if (name == null)
return null;
if (value == null)
value = QueryUtil.ANY;
return QueryUtil.createIUPropertyQuery(name, value);
}
return null;
}
private Map<String, String> processQueryAttributes(String attributes) {
if (attributes == null || attributes.length() == 0)
return Collections.emptyMap();
Map<String, String> result = new HashMap<>();
int start = 0;
int idx = 0;
while ((idx = attributes.indexOf('@', start)) > -1) {
int equals = attributes.indexOf('=', idx);
int startQuote = attributes.indexOf('\'', equals);
int endQuote = attributes.indexOf('\'', startQuote + 1);
if (equals == -1 || startQuote <= equals || endQuote <= startQuote)
break;
String key = attributes.substring(idx + 1, equals).trim();
String value = attributes.substring(startQuote + 1, endQuote);
result.put(key, value);
start = endQuote + 1;
}
return result;
}
